Srinagar: As the chill of winter gradually gives way to the gentle warmth of spring, the iconic ‘Badamwari Garden’ here has come alive with the breathtaking beauty of almond bloom, much to the delight of locals who eagerly anticipate this annual spectacle.

“For us Kashmiris, the blooming of almond trees in Badamwari Garden is a cherished and beautiful view that marks the beginning of spring,” said Aazan, a resident of Zafran Colony Srinagar. “It’s a sight that fills our hearts with joy and reminds us of the resilience of our land.”

Rahul, one of the visitors from Mumbai, told the that the enchanting beauty of Badamwari Garden’s almond bloom, and the arrival of spring is like seeing heaven with your naked eyes.

The vibrant hues of pink and white blossoms against the backdrop of snow-capped mountains evoke a sense of wonder and reverence among the people.

The beauty of Badamwari Garden during almond bloom is unparalleled, Sahil, a local said, adding that it is like stepping into a fairytale, where every tree is adorned with delicate flowers.

Families are gathered amidst the blossoms to celebrate the arrival of spring, and the air is filled with a festive look—(KNO)
